Operation Sea-Spray
Bio-weapon tests on San Francisco
Two strains of bacteria were sprayed across the Bay Area by the US Navy in 1950 - to determine how vulnerable they would be to a bioweapon attack. Speculation of the experiment is that it lead to 1x death and 10 illnesses although there's no direct way to link the two.
MKUltra
Psychoactive Drug Research
Testing done by the CIA between 1953 - 1973 to develop methods and identify drugs that could be used for interrogations, either to weaken individuals through psychological torture or brainwashing to confess.
The acting CIA director then destroyed the files related to MKUltra before the program was revealed in 1975.
Tuskegee Syphilis Study
Study tests conducted from 1932 - 1972 by the PHS & CDC on a group of 600 African American men who they drew blood for and learned that 400 of them had syphilis -- and wanted to observe the effects of the disease when untreated.
The two organizations did not make them aware, instead running tests on them and promising them free medical care. More than 100 men died as a result of the experiment and were never informed of the nature of the experiment.
Gulf of Tonkin Incident
Partially fake US Attack precursor for Vietnam War escalation.
A USS Destroyer fired warning shots at North Vietnamese torpedo boats - and all vessels were damaged in the confrontation.
The US then stated there was a 2nd attack - which years later they confirmed never happened - which led to the US president making a speech on the Vietnam War that night and opening a line with the Soviets about broadening the war.
Operation Northwoods
US Proposal to set-up crimes & blame on Cuba
A false flag operation set by the Department of Defense, it called for CIA operatives to stage acts of terrorism against American military & civilian targets - then blaming them on the Cuban government for justification in a war against Cuba.
The proposals were rejected by John F. Kennedy.
Portugal President is a "Templar" Leader
Back when the Templars were excommunicated by the Pope in 1312 and sentenced to death - the king of Portugal named Dinis gave them refuge (partially because they helped conquer lands the Portugese claimed).
He delayed trying them & created a new 'Ordem de Christo' that took them in as members.
The organization today is more of a symbolic club although the position of leader is still the president of Portugal.
Mandela Effect
A specific form of false memories that's shared with a large group of people.
The term came from a paranormal researcher who reported remembering seeing news of Nelson Mandela dying during the 1980s in prison, although he actually died in 2013 after serving as president over 10 years after release.
The most common examples are:
> Berenstain vs Berenstein Bears.
> Logo of Fruit of the Loom logo having a cornucopia.
> Darth Vader saying "Luke, I am your father" - instead "No, I am your father"
> Mr. Monopoly wearing a monocole

Titantic Did Not Sink Theory
Fake
A idea brought up in a 1998 book by Robin Gardiner.
He claimed the ship was swapped out with its sister ship Olympic before the sinking, as an insurance scam by its owners JP Morgan.
The theory is dismissed because of how difficult it would be to secretly swap the entire crew & passengers - especially with how different the ships were.
